Specification:
Basic Parameters
Brand: FlyingRC
Model: F4WSE Pro
Item Name: Fixed-wing Flight Control
Dimensions: 22.6mm × 42.8mm × 9mm
Weight: 9.1g
Sensors
IMU (only accelerometer): ICM-42688-P
Barometer: SPA06-001
Magnetometer: None (No onboard magnetometer)
OSD Module: AT7465E
Main Control
Main Control Chip: STM32F405RGT6
Clock Speed: 168MHz
Flash: 1 MB
RAM: 192k
Power Supply
BEC Core Model: MP9943 + MP9447
Board Operating Voltage BEC - Device: 5V3A
Board Operating Voltage BEC - Motor: 5V5A
Ports
Number of UARTs: 6 ports (UART1, UART2, UART3, UART4, UART5, UART6)
PWM: Total 12 outputs, 2.54mm pitch connectors, includes 6 times PWM outputs and dual wiring for four motors.
I2C: Supported
ADC Sampling: Continuous mode supports up to 80A, peak 120A.
SWD Debugging: Supported
Wireless Module: Supports external wireless receiver.
LED Light Interface: Supports WS2812, controller supports up to 12 lights.
USB Type-C: External USB access supported.
TF Card Slot: Supports TF cards, max size 4GB, maximum storage 32GB.
SBUS: SBUS receiver lineup supported (UART2 RX port).
Firmware Support
Betaflight: Supported (default firmware)
INAV: Supported
Ardupilot: Supported
PX4: Not supported
Operating Environment
VBAT Voltage Range: 7-28V DC IN, 2-6S LiPo
Input Voltage: Same as VBAT Voltage Range
Operating Temperature Range: -10°C to 100°C
Storage Temperature Range: 0°C to 40°C
Compared to the F4WSE, the F4WSE Pro version features the following upgrades:
1. Upgraded Boot button for easier use.
2. No soldering required for the USB mini-board.
3. Direct connection to a 4-in-1 ESC for easy quadcopter VTOL setup.
4. Direct connection to receivers, GPS, and HD aerial terminals.
5. Added dual analog camera switching function.
6. Upgraded PCB technology to 20Z thick copper plate, enhancing the current meter's continuous overcurrent capability.
